List Host Metric Summary Monthlys
/api/v2/host_metric_summary_monthly/
Make a GET request to this resource to retrieve the list of host metric summary monthlys.
The resulting data structure contains:
{
"count": 99,
"next": null,
"previous": null,
"results": [
...
]
}
The count field indicates the total number of host metric summary monthlys
found for the given query. The next and previous fields provides links to
additional results if there are more than will fit on a single page. The
results list contains zero or more host metric summary monthly records.
Results
Each host metric summary monthly data structure includes the following fields:
id: Database ID for this host metric summary monthly. (integer)date: (date)license_consumed: How many unique hosts are consumed from the license (integer)license_capacity: 'License capacity as max. number of unique hosts (integer)hosts_added: How many hosts were added in the associated month, consuming more license capacity (integer)hosts_deleted: How many hosts were deleted in the associated month, freeing the license capacity (integer)indirectly_managed_hosts: Manually entered number indirectly managed hosts for a certain month (integer)
Sorting
To specify that host metric summary monthlys are returned in a particular
order, use the order_by query string parameter on the GET request.
?order_by=name
Prefix the field name with a dash - to sort in reverse:
?order_by=-name
Multiple sorting fields may be specified by separating the field names with a
comma ,:
?order_by=name,some_other_field
Pagination
Use the page_size query string parameter to change the number of results
returned for each request. Use the page query string parameter to retrieve
a particular page of results.
?page_size=100&page=2
The previous and next links returned with the results will set these query
string parameters automatically.
Searching
Use the search query string parameter to perform a case-insensitive search
within all designated text fields of a model.
?search=findme
(Added in Ansible Tower 3.1.0) Search across related fields:
?related__search=findme
Request
- application/json
-
page: integer
A page number within the paginated result set.
-
page_size: integer
Number of results to return per page.
-
search: string
A search term.
Response
- application/json
200 Response
object-
date:
string(date)
Title:
DateRead Only:true -
hosts_added:
integer
Title:
Hosts addedRead Only:trueHow many hosts were added in the associated month, consuming more license capacity -
hosts_deleted:
integer
Title:
Hosts deletedRead Only:trueHow many hosts were deleted in the associated month, freeing the license capacity -
id:
integer
Title:
IDRead Only:true -
indirectly_managed_hosts:
integer
Title:
Indirectly managed hostsRead Only:trueManually entered number indirectly managed hosts for a certain month -
license_capacity:
integer
Title:
License capacityRead Only:true'License capacity as max. number of unique hosts -
license_consumed:
integer
Title:
License consumedRead Only:trueHow many unique hosts are consumed from the license